Corem sells 14 properties in Sweden for €101m

Corem Property Group has agreed to sell a portfolio of 14 properties in Gothenburg, Huddinge, Norrköping, and Västerås for an estimated SEK 1.2 bn (€101.4m), matching their book value.

These properties, totaling around 72,100 m2, include office, warehouse, and retail spaces. They generate SEK 111 mln (€10.17 mln) in rental income with an economic occupancy rate of about 92%.
Specifically, the sale includes leaseholds in Gothenburg (Tuve 86:2 and Tynnered 1:15) and properties in Mölndal (Gastuben 3, Hårddisken 3, Kryptongasen 8, Neongasen 2). In Huddinge, Rektangeln 3 at Kungens Kurva is being divested. Norrköping sees the sale of Bronsen 2, Kopparn 10, and Platinan 1 in the Ingelsta industrial area. Finally, in Västerås, Kranlinan 1, Traversföraren 1, Traversföraren 3 in the Erikslund retail area, and Sjöhagen 12 are included.
The transfer of these properties to the buyer, Areim, is scheduled for October 1.
Peeter Kinnunen, head of Transactions at Corem, said: "With this sale, we continue to free up capital and further strengthen the balance sheet."
